Shen Mountain Tribe Culinary School Introduction

The Shenshan Tribal Culinary School is located along Provincial Highway 24, nestled in the Shenshan tribal area of Wutai Township, where mountain mist lingers throughout the year, creating a picturesque landscape. Recently, it has developed the "Tribal Culinary School," which is Taiwan's first tribal culinary experience, guiding travelers into the fields to learn about familiar yet unfamiliar ingredients. Through cooking, visitors can experience the charm of the indigenous homeland. For instance, the false horned fruit is a common wild vegetable found in the tribe, often seen in front of many households, and it is an essential ingredient in the traditional Rukai dish "cinabu." At the Tribal Culinary School, guests can enjoy the fun of gathering ingredients and DIY cooking experiences. It is recommended to stay for at least 3 hours, and prior reservation with the community development association is required to participate in the experience. Visitors must also apply for a mountain entry permit to enter Wutai Township, and large buses are prohibited from passing through.
